A Microsoft Azure Case Study
viaSport is a British Columbia not‑for‑profit created after the 2010 Paralympic Games to build a more inclusive sport culture across the province. With more than 661,000 registered members and responsibility for connecting people to play, coach, officiate and volunteer, viaSport struggled to efficiently respond to a high volume of individual inquiries and to deliver tailored information for people with diverse needs and abilities.
To solve this, viaSport partnered with Microsoft to deploy an intelligent chatbot built on Azure and the LUIS-enabled bot framework. The chatbot delivers contextual, personalized answers by ability, interest and location, reduces staff workload, provides faster and more private responses for users, and captures analytics for continuous improvement — with plans to add voice, mobile access, resource ranking and sentiment analysis to further expand accessibility and service quality.
